This was a very easy and interesting class. If you are good at memorization then this class will be very easy for you! He gives a study guide before the midterm and final that is exactly the same as the real exam. You technically only have to put in 4-5 days memorizing throughout the whole quarter to get an A+ in the class.
It's funny because I did not know how to rate his helpfulness because I rarely needed help in the course (except after a death in my family, which he was extremely supportive about). It was so organized. He made everything clear and really is one of the most pleasant people I have ever met. He is just a delight, he is knowledgeable and very funny. We had a midterm and a final. They both consisted of people identification (from a list of relevant people, we had to write down their occupation, 2-3 films they were associated with, and 2 biographical facts), film identification (by dialogue for the midterm, and then by image for the final), and then an essay. I am super anxious about exams but these went well for me. As long as you pay attention to the material, it will be an easy experience.
I learned so much about Ingmar Bergman and Swedish film in general, and I want to keep the slides and my notes forever because he made it all so interesting. I would love to take another course with Lunde. I'd also just love to be Lunde's friend because like I said he's just a delight. Definitely recommend anything he teaches.
